Lynn Pressman Raymond (c. 1912 – July 22, 2009) was an American business executive who joined her husband in developing and growing the Pressman Toy Corporation, and was an innovator in creating and licensing toys based on hit television programs and professional athletes in her two decades as president of the firm following her husband's death in 1959.
